1. **Salsa vs. Guacamole**: - **Salsa**: Salsa is a popular condiment made with tomatoes, onions, chili peppers, and cilantro. It is often served with tortilla chips or used as a topping for tacos and burritos. Salsa comes in many variations, from mild to spicy, and can be chunky or smooth. - **Guacamole**: Guacamole is a dip made from mashed avocados mixed with lime juice, onions, tomatoes, and cilantro. It has a creamy texture and a rich, flavorful taste. Guacamole is perfect for dipping chips or as a topping for tacos and nachos. 2. **Tortillas vs. Arepas**: - **Tortillas**: Tortillas are thin, flatbreads made from corn or wheat flour. They are a staple in Mexican cuisine and are used to make dishes like tacos, burritos, and enchiladas. Tortillas come in different sizes and can be either soft or crispy. - **Arepas**: Arepas are a type of cornmeal bread that is popular in Colombia and Venezuela. They are thicker and more doughy than tortillas and can be served plain or stuffed with fillings like cheese, meat, or beans. Arepas are versatile and can be enjoyed for breakfast, lunch, or dinner. 3. **Plantains vs. Yuca**: - **Plantains**: Plantains are a starchy fruit similar to bananas but with a different flavor and texture. They are a common ingredient in Latin American cuisine and can be fried, baked, or mashed. Plantains are often served as a side dish or snack and can be sweet or savory, depending on how they are prepared. - **Yuca**: Yuca, also known as cassava, is a root vegetable that is widely used in Latin American cooking. It has a mild, slightly sweet flavor and a starchy texture. Yuca can be boiled, fried, or mashed and is used in dishes like soups, stews, and casseroles. 4. **Dulce de Leche vs. Flan**: - **Dulce de Leche**: Dulce de leche is a sweet caramel-like spread made from simmering sweetened milk. It is popular in many Latin American countries and is used in desserts like cakes, pastries, and ice cream. Dulce de leche has a rich, creamy consistency and a sweet, indulgent flavor. - **Flan**: Flan is a creamy custard dessert with a caramel topping. It is made with ingredients like eggs, milk, and sugar and is baked in a water bath to create a smooth texture. Flan is a classic Latin American dessert and is enjoyed for its rich flavor and silky texture.
